People Moves: UK University Snaps up Hedge Fund Guru

New York (HedgeCo.net) – In a move that turns the table on the hiring status quo, Strathclyde University has reached out into the world of hedge funds to access talent. In announcing that it has just appointed Daniel Broby as a Visiting Professor, it has shown that rocket scientists can go the other way in the war for talent.

Broby, based in London, hopes his appointment will prove invaluable in giving the department’s postgraduate students’ real life insights into the world of both hedge funds and traditional fund management. The visting position is a part time one and Broby continues in his day job as deputy chief executive of British based frontier absolute return manager SilkInvest.

Broby was elected an individual member of the London Stock Exchange in 1990; is a Fellow of Chartered Institute of Securities and Investment; a Fellow of CFA UK and a Visiting fellow at Durham University.

Daniel Broby, who launched Denmark’s first listed and regulated hedge fund said: “I will try to get across that alpha is out there for those that put in the effort, do their research and out think market rivals. For those that don’t, they may as well remain beta investor’s.”

Strathclyde Business School was ranked 1st in the UK for Accounting & Finance by The Sunday Times University Guide 2011.

Daniel Broby began his fund management career in 1985 and has witnessed the transformation of the industry from “pre big bang” to “post credit crisis”. Prior to specialising in alternative and frontier investment strategies, he was awarded the top rating of five morning stars for the performance of the flagship global fund that he ran for eight years whilst in Denmark.

Broby was recognized for his contribution to the industry by the CFA institute who awarded him its Society Leader Award. No doubt, his colleagues at “the Institute” and fellow “Hedgies” will be calling him the “Professor” from now on.
